1. Avoid travelling during peak times and think about cycling and walking rather than taking public transport.2. If you’re driving, plan your route including any breaks before you set out.
Your household or support bubble can travel together in a vehicle.3. Check your car is safe and roadworthy if you haven’t used it for a while.4.
Watch out for more pedestrians and cyclists on the road – and leave room for social distancing at traffic lights.5. Limit the time you spend at garages, petrol stations and motorway services, pay by contactless and keep your distance.6.
Wash or sanitise your hands regularly – and always when exiting or re-entering your vehicle and at the end of your journey.7.
